Team — launch locked for the Corvane handheld scanner. Timeline: press preview week one, retail availability week three, Ashfell region first. Inventory staged at the Dunmarrow depot; no slippage expected. Pricing holds at the agreed point; no introductory discount. Marketing spend front-loaded, 60% in the first fortnight. Support staffing doubled through launch month. Risks: firmware patch pending, courier capacity tight. Decisions needed by Thursday. Board sees this plus the confidential note appended directly beneath this message.

board note of kageg-bahof: The renewal with Holwynax Holdings closes at $2 million a year, 5 percent below the last contract. Project Ulaath slips by two quarters because of the supplier delay.

Handover — Bloom filter for Kestrelstore. Support team: the bloom filter sits in front of the Kestrelstore key-value cluster and short-circuits lookups for keys that definitely don't exist. It's rebuilt nightly by the Lanternjob worker; a stale filter causes false negatives, which show up as "missing key" complaints despite successful writes. If you need to trigger a manual rebuild, use the operator console on the Marwick host. The rebuild command prompts for the recovery passphrase, which is below.

vault phrase of bagaf-kajeg = jorath-feniel-briir-siliel-ralix

### Action Item: Spoolhaven Retry Storm

From last Tuesday's outage: the Spoolhaven print service retried failed jobs without backoff, saturating the render pool. Fix merged; retries now use capped exponential backoff with jitter. Owner will monitor for a week before closing. The agreed retry constants are recorded below.

constants for yadup-kajof:
RATE_LIMITS = {
    "zorwyn": 1,
    "druwyn": 1,
}